Wesław Ochman ( Polish: Wiesław Ochman ; February 6, 1937 , Warsaw , Poland) - Polish opera singer (lyric tenor). Belcanto master.

Biography
He graduated from the Academy. Stanislava Staszica ( Krakow ). In 1963-1964 sang in Krakow. From 1964-1970 soloist of the Wielka Theater (Warsaw). He also performed at the German Opera (Berlin), the Opera House (Munich), the Opera House (Hamburg), the Paris Opera , the Metropolitan Opera (New York), Chicago , San Francisco , La Scala (Milan), the Bolshoi Theater ( Moscow), with the Vienna Philharmonic Orchestra and the Berlin Philharmonic Orchestra and others. A regular participant in music festivals in Glyndeborn (Great Britain), Salzburg (Austria) and others. He is the UNICEF Goodwill Ambassador .
